His beautiful voice was first streamed on social media platforms as he posted his first-ever song cover entitled When We Were Young by Adele. This content of his hit over millions of views and counting.

Zaleb Brown had a hard time opening up his potential to the whole world. For years of his life, he started singing in private. He never thought that he could make it up to the place right where he is today.

Although his family is an avid fan of music, which probably influenced him to sing, he still opted to hide his talent.

One of the explanations for restraining himself from sharing his voice is because he had a stutter. However, back in 2016, he managed to overcome such negativity brought by the speech disorder and started his singing career.

Starting small by just making song covers, Zaleb has already released two singles entitled Unconditional and Projection.

These singles are his collaborations with his brother, Jdagr8.

His solid exemplars are his favorites— Adele, Khalid, his brother Jdagr8, Justin Bieber, Post Malone, and more. He has also been crafting different ideas from the styles and genres adopted by these people.

His recent single release, Projection, is a soulful Pop x R&B music accompanied by smooth EDM overlay. Its lyrics deeply strike right thru the feelings of every listener.

On the other hand, Unconditional conveys an inspiring message. It was intentionally dedicated to strengthen and appreciate the part taken by the family when the odds come along. The two are now available on many streaming platforms, including Spotify and YouTube.
